Joseph Judah Levinsky MD passed away December 24, 2024 following a lengthy illness.
Joe was born to Israel and Leah Levinsky on May 7 1946. He graduated from Haddonfield High School, Franklin and Marshall College and Jefferson Medical College. He did his internship and residency at Rainbow Babies and Children's Hospital in Cleveland.
Joe began his medical career in private practice as a pediatrician. He then worked as an Emergency Room physician at Cooper Hospital and then Virtua Emergency Department where he was chief of the department for 11 years. He also worked at Jersey Shore Medical Center. He returned to his first love of pediatric and emergency medicine at St Christopher's Hospital for Children in Philadelphia for the last 25 years of his career. While he was there, he received Teacher of the Year which was voted on by the residents. This was one of his proudest moments of his medical career. Joe was also an accomplished artist. His mediums included painting, drawing and wood cuts. He loved doing pictures of his grandchildren and his friends and family.
